Crafted from 100% Supima Cotton with a mercerized finish, this fabric offers an ultra-smooth texture, enhanced durability, and a refined sheen. The mercerization process strengthens the fibers, improving color vibrancy and resistance to pilling, ensuring a premium look and feel.

With a GSM of 230-240, the fabric provides a substantial yet breathable weight, making it ideal for elegant and long-lasting polo shirts. The Piqué Knit structure enhances texture, breathability, and moisture-wicking properties, ensuring superior comfort.

The fabric undergoes a Bio-Silicon Wash, giving it a silky touch and enhanced softness, while preshrinking ensures shape retention and minimizes shrinkage over time. Dyed using a Soft Flow Azo-Free process, it meets eco-friendly standards for sustainability and skin safety.

Designed with a classic polo collar with a structured stand and ribbed cuffing, this style exudes sophistication and durability. The collar stand ensures a sharp, refined look, while the ribbed cuffs provide a snug, comfortable fit, adding a polished and tailored touch to the garment.

What is Supima Cotton?

Supima cotton is a high-quality cotton grown exclusively in the United States, known for its superior softness, strength, and color retention. It’s a type of extra-long staple (ELS) cotton, meaning its fibers are at least 1.5 inches long, which gives it unique benefits compared to regular cotton. The long fibers make Supima cotton more durable, resistant to pilling, and better at holding dyes, resulting in vibrant colors that last longer. This makes it a premium choice for high-end clothing, bed linens, and other textiles where comfort, durability, and color quality are prioritized.

The name “Supima” is a blend of “superior” and “Pima,” with Pima cotton being another type of ELS cotton known for similar qualities but not necessarily grown in the U.S.
